My sister and I choose this cruise due to our desire to see Russia. Our other motivation was Viking was offering free airfare in the year 2018 for this cruise.

The ship shape is differ from the long ships Viking uses for their other river cruises. But once the cruise was started and we could feel the open waters we were cruising we understood the reason why.

We absolutely loved our cruise. The biggest factor contributing to this result, other than the amazing Russian cites we visited , was the crew onboard the Akun. They went above and beyond to make sure each passenger was enjoying themselves. Those working the front desk went to great extremes to accommodate a special sightseeing request that my sister and I had to tour the Hermitage storage facility.

Cabin Review

Deluxe Outside Stateroom

Cabin CX

The cabin did not have a veranda but a large window that pulled down. To my surprise we did not miss having a veranda, which we have had in the past. We were just to busy.

The size was slightly larger than the DX and had no poles in the center of the room. Due to the length of the cruise we felt the extra space was advantageous.

My only complaint was one particular night there was a lot of noise going through a lock, which I assume was from the engines. But I found out the engines were located in the opposite end of the ship. So unsure what was causing the noise. Unclear if you had a room higher up if the noise would have been as loud.
